Typical Reasons for Calling an Emergency Car Locksmith
Locked Keys Inside the Car
- This is one of the most typical reasons people discover themselves in need of an emergency situation car locksmith. It's simple to lock your keys in the car, particularly if you're in a hurry or distracted.
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
- Losing or having your car keys stolen can be a considerable trouble and a security threat. An emergency car locksmith can supply immediate assistance to protect your vehicle and replace the lost or stolen keys.
Key Fob Malfunction
- Modern cars often feature key fobs that can malfunction due to battery problems, water damage, or basic wear and tear. A locksmith can detect the problem and offer a solution, consisting of reprogramming or changing the fob.
Broken Lock Cylinder
- Gradually, the lock cylinder in your car can break or break. An emergency car locksmith can repair or replace the cylinder, ensuring your car stays secure.
Frozen Locks
- In colder environments, locks can freeze, making it difficult to unlock your car. A locksmith has the competence to safely thaw and unlock frozen locks.

What to Expect When You Call an Emergency Car Locksmith
Preliminary Contact
- When you call an emergency situation car locksmith, you'll likely speak with a dispatcher who will collect fundamental info about your circumstance, such as your place, the kind of car, and the specific concern you're dealing with.
Dispatch and Arrival Time
- The dispatcher will dispatch a locksmith to your place. The majority of credible services aim to arrive within 30 minutes to an hour. However, wait times can vary depending on the need and the locksmith's schedule.
Assessment and Service
- When the locksmith gets here, they will evaluate the scenario and offer you with a quote of the expense and time needed to solve the concern. They will then use their specialized tools to unlock your car, replicate keys, or repair the lock.
Payment and Documentation
- After the service is completed, the locksmith will supply you with a comprehensive invoice. Payment approaches can differ, but most locksmiths accept money, credit cards, and digital payments. It's likewise an excellent idea to ask for a receipt and any essential documentation, specifically if you require to file an insurance claim.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does an emergency situation car locksmith service expense?
- A: The cost can vary depending upon the service needed, the place, and the time of day. Typically, you can expect to pay in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for an emergency unlock. More complex services, such as key duplication or lock replacement, may cost more.
Q: Can an emergency car locksmith aid if my key fob is dead?
- A: Yes, many emergency situation car locksmith professionals are geared up to deal with key fob problems. They can replace the battery, reprogram the fob, and even replace the whole fob if essential.
Q: What should I do if I can't discover my car keys and I think they might be inside the car?
- A: If you're uncertain whether your keys are inside the car, attempt checking out the windows for any signs of the keys. If you can't see them, and you're specific they are inside, call an emergency situation car locksmith. They can securely open your car without triggering damage.
Q: Is it legal for an emergency car locksmith to open my car without a key?
- A: Yes, it is legal for a licensed and bonded emergency situation car locksmith to open your car without a key. However, they may require you to offer evidence of ownership, such as a chauffeur's license or a vehicle registration.
Q: How can I avoid the requirement for an emergency situation car locksmith?
- A: To reduce the danger of needing an emergency situation car locksmith, consider the following tips:
- Keep a Spare Key: Store a spare type in a safe location, such as a safe or with a trusted pal.
- Regular Maintenance: Have your car's locks and key fobs examined regularly to capture any problems before they become emergencies.
- Key Fob Battery Check: Regularly examine the battery in your key fob and replace it when required.
- Keyless Entry: Consider investing in a keyless entry system for your car, which can lower the risk of locking yourself out.
Q: Can an emergency car locksmith deal with all types of automobiles?
- A: Most emergency situation car locksmiths are trained to deal with a wide variety of automobiles, including modern-day cars with intricate key fobs and older models with easier locks. However, some concentrate on specific makes and designs, so it's an excellent concept to inspect their competence before booking a service.
